Easter 2022: What's Hop-ening In Mokena?

Easter is April 17, but that's not stopping some Mokena organizations from hosting Easter-themed events earlier than that.

MOKENA, IL — Spring has sprung, and Easter is right around the corner. That means it's time for egg decorating, egg hunts, visits from the Eater bunny and more in Mokena. While Easter isn't until April 17, there are plenty of Easter-themed events happening in town before then. Patch is keeping a list of where to find kid and family-friendly events in town. Check out some of the events in the list below.


  • Mokena Community Park District Adult Egg Hunt, Yunker Farm Park at 10824 LaPorte Road - April 8 from 7 p.m. to 8:30 p.m. Cost is $30 for Mokena residents, $35 for non-residents. Why let the kids have all the fun? This event will feature an Easter egg hunt, games and a light buffet dinner. Adults 21 and over only. Registration is open until April 1.   • Mokena Lions Club Egg Hunt, Main Park at 10925 LaPorte Road - April 9 starting at noon. The egg hunt will be divided into three age groups. The Mokena Lions Club is stuffing more than 8,000 eggs, but those will undoubtedly go fast! Plus, a visit from a fuzzy friend or two is expected.   • Pet Pictures with the Easter Bunny, Resale for Rescues, 11134 Front St. - April 10 from 11 a.m. to noon. A $5 donation is requested. The donation will come with a raffle ticket for an Easter basket filled with goodies. Winner need not be present to win.
  • Mokena Community Park District Flashlight Egg Hunt, Yunker Farm Park at 10824 LaPorte Road - April 12 from 6:30 to 8 p.m. Registration is required. Open for ages 8-13. Cost is $13 for residents, $15 for non-residents. Use your flashlight to search for hidden eggs with prizes inside. If you find a golden egg, you'll get a basket of goodies.
